Minimalist Floating Nightstands for a Sleek Look
Floating nightstands create a clean, uncluttered look while maximizing floor space. These wall-mounted designs are perfect for modern bedrooms and can be paired with hidden LED lighting for a futuristic touch.
Smart Nightstands with Built-in Charging Stations
Technology meets functionality with smart nightstands that feature built-in USB ports, wireless charging pads, and touch-activated lighting.
Rustic Wooden Nightstands for a Cozy Feel
For a warm and inviting atmosphere, rustic wooden nightstands bring natural textures and timeless charm. Opt for distressed wood, reclaimed materials, or farmhouse-style finishes.
Industrial Metal and Wood Nightstands for a Bold Aesthetic
Industrial-style nightstands blend metal and wood for an edgy, urban look. Perfect for modern lofts or masculine bedrooms, these designs feature exposed bolts, raw textures, and minimalist silhouettes.
Mirrored Nightstands for a Glamorous Touch
Mirrored nightstands add a touch of elegance and sophistication while reflecting light to make a small bedroom appear larger.
Scandinavian-Inspired Nightstands with Clean Lines
Scandinavian nightstands focus on simplicity, functionality, and natural elements. Look for light wood tones, tapered legs, and neutral colors to create a clean, uncluttered aesthetic.
Multi-Tiered Nightstands for Extra Storage
For those who need extra storage space, multi-tiered nightstands offer open shelving and additional compartments for organizing books, decor, and essentials.
Vintage Nightstands with Distressed Finishes
For a classic and timeless touch, vintage nightstands feature ornate carvings, curved legs, and distressed paint finishes.
Leather-Wrapped Nightstands for a Luxe Touch
For a high-end, luxurious look, leather-wrapped nightstands provide sophistication and texture to your bedroom decor. Whether in classic black, warm brown, or deep navy blue, this design works well in modern and contemporary spaces.
Reclaimed Wood Nightstands for a Sustainable Choice
Sustainability remains a top trend in 2025, and reclaimed wood nightstands bring a rustic, eco-friendly touch to any bedroom. These nightstands feature natural textures, distressed finishes, and unique wood grains.
Multi-Functional Nightstands with Built-in Desks
For small bedrooms or multi-purpose spaces, a nightstand that doubles as a desk is a practical and stylish choice. This trend is perfect for compact apartments and home offices.
High-Gloss Nightstands for a Contemporary Edge
For a sleek, modern bedroom, high-gloss nightstands provide a polished and reflective finish, adding a minimalist, futuristic feel. White, grey, or black gloss finishes work best for contemporary interiors.
Bedside Tables with Hidden Compartments for Privacy
For those who love hidden storage solutions, nightstands with secret compartments offer both security and style. These are perfect for storing valuables, jewelry, or personal belongings discreetly.
Acrylic Nightstands for a Futuristic Look
Acrylic nightstands offer a sleek and futuristic appeal, perfect for modern and minimalist bedrooms. Their transparent design makes them ideal for small spaces, as they create the illusion of openness. Pair with LED lighting and metallic decor for an ultra-modern feel.
Compact Nightstands for Small Bedrooms
For small bedrooms, a compact nightstand is essential. Opt for narrow or tall bedside tables with built-in drawers or shelves for extra storage. Choose a light wood finish or white lacquer to keep the space bright and airy.
Nightstands with Built-in LED Lighting
A nightstand with built-in LED lighting is both stylish and practical. Integrated soft glow lighting enhances the bedroom’s ambiance while providing functional illumination for nighttime reading. Pair with modern decor and a sleek upholstered bed.
Two-Tone Nightstands for a Modern Contrast
Two-tone nightstands bring a modern and artistic touch to bedroom interiors. Choose a black and white combination, wood and metal mix, or pastel contrast to add visual depth. These nightstands work well in both contemporary and classic settings.
Round Nightstands for a Soft and Elegant Style
A round nightstand softens the lines of a bedroom, making it feel more inviting. Opt for wood, marble, or glass finishes to complement various interior styles. These work particularly well in boho, mid-century, and modern spaces.
Wicker and Rattan Nightstands for a Boho Feel
For a boho-chic bedroom, opt for a wicker or rattan nightstand. These textured pieces add warmth and a natural aesthetic, blending perfectly with earthy tones, greenery, and woven decor elements.
Floating Drawer Nightstands for a Space-Saving Solution
A floating drawer nightstand is an excellent choice for small bedrooms, providing storage without taking up floor space. Choose a minimalist wooden or high-gloss finish to blend seamlessly with modern and contemporary interiors.
Glass Nightstands for a Light and Airy Aesthetic
A glass nightstand offers a sophisticated and airy look, perfect for modern and luxurious bedrooms. Pair with metallic legs, soft lighting, and elegant decor for a chic and refined feel.
